    Abstract: A strip of metal is wrapped into a ring configuration such that ends of the strip are positioned in a predetermined relationship to each other. The ends of the strip are attached together by a temporary weld joining the two ends of the strip, thereby forming a temporary continuous ring. After heat treating the temporary continuous ring, the ring is separated at the temporary weld to provide a heat treated split bearing ring with a controlled clearance at the split.

    Abstract: A method for making a multiple piece crankshaft from a shaft and a crankpin is disclosed. A notch is first machined on an intermediate section of the shaft such that the notch has a length slightly less than the length of the crankpin. Mating surfaces are then formed on the shaft at opposite ends of the notch. Thereafter, the crankpin is positioned on the mating surfaces on the shaft so that the crankpin is parallel to and spaced from an axis of the shaft. The ends of the crankpin are then secured to the mating surfaces formed on the crankshaft and a portion of the intermediate section of the shaft is then removed by machining. A counterweight is finally positioned over each end of the crankpin at its juncture with the main shaft and secured to the crankpin and shaft thereby forming the crankshaft. Alternatively, the crankpin is positioned on mating surfaces formed on the counterweights and fasteners then secure the crankpin, counterweights and main shaft together.

    Abstract: A method of manufacturing a wheel rim for a two-piece vehicle wheel assembly. The method includes the step of casting a one-piece alloy wheel form. The wheel form defines an integrally-formed annular rim blank and supporting center. The rim blank includes opposing first and second annular edge portions. The first annular edge portion of the rim blank is machined, and then the second annular edge portion of the rim blank is machined. After the machining steps, the one-piece wheel form is cut to separate the machined wheel rim from the supporting center.

  • Patent number: 5791039
    Abstract: A magnetic clutch includes a rotor and an armature facing to each other for establishing a coupling connection. A serpentine magnetic circuit is formed in the rotor and the armature. A method for manufacturing a rotor of a magnetic clutch of the invention comprises the step of deforming a single ring-shaped plate of a magnetic material, by a plastic deformation process such as cold forging, into a ring-shaped element comprising generally concentric inner and outer cylindrical walls, and a ring-shaped bottom wall. Prior to or after or simultaneously with this step, ring grooves are formed on the bottom wall. A nonmagnetic material is then filled in the ring grooves, and the bottom surface of the bottom wall is cut to form a friction surface. By this cutting, the nonmagnetic material is exposed at the friction surface.

  • Patent number: 5638595
    Abstract: A method is provided for fabricating a gradient coil for an MR imaging system having an open magnet. The method includes forming a structure from thin conductive material such as copper, the structure generally comprising a section of a cylinder and a section of an annulus joined to an edge of the cylinder section as a flange. During a first cutting operation, a plurality of first groove segments are cut through the material, each of the first groove segments lying in one of a plurality of cutting zones selectively positioned around the structure, a strip of material positioned between two adjacent groove segments comprising a coil turn segment. The coil turn segments of a cutting zone are rigidly joined to one another and to a support frame comprising the outer edge of the structure by suitable means. Thereafter, a second cutting operation is performed, whereby a plurality of second groove segments are cut through the material to completely form the gradient coil.

  • Patent number: 5577312
    Abstract: In a method of separating a product G connected to a skeleton portion S of work W via a micro joint M, from the skeleton portion, the product is separated from the skeleton portion by striking the skeleton portion in the vicinity of the micro joint to cut off the micro joint from the skeleton. Further, the die pair used for the above-mentioned method comprises a punch 17A provided with a projecting portion 17T at an end thereof and movable up and down; and a die 19A arranged under the punch and formed of an elastic substance. In this method, it is possible to separate products from the skeleton portion of the work efficiently by breaking the micro joints without scratching the products and without generating noise. Further, the separating work of the products from the skeleton portion can be easily automated.

  • Patent number: 5416962
    Abstract: A vibration damper is formed from two metal layers. The first metal layer is coated with primer layers, slit, and partially stamped to form a strip holding a plurality of vibration damper blanks. Each of these blanks has a body portion and tab portions. A second metal layer is formed separately by coating a second metal strip with adhesive and stamping it to form a plurality of vibration damper blanks but without tabs. The two strips are aligned, bonded together and the vibration dampers are formed and stamped out. (The tabs, which are only on one layer, are bent to form clips.) Due to this construction the clips cannot delaminate and provide a noiseless metal contact with the shoe plate, while an improved adhesive can be employed to bond the two metal layers together.
